Compression & Encryption Technologies Shipping Products
To Brazil

EDMONTON, ALBERTA--Compression & Encryption Technologies Inc.
(CYH) is pleased to announce that Masterway Telecomunicacoes Ltda
(Sao Paulo, Brazil) has recently purchased Datamaster and
Framemaster products to introduce the CYH product line to the
Brazil telecommunications market. Masterway was founded in 1988 to
provide consulting and support in the area of telecommunications.
The business has since grown to include sales and support of data
communications hardware products such as Paradyne, OpenConnect and
Cisco. The Masterway service offerings include the resale of
Internet access bandwidth for Embratel, a major carrier in Brazil.
Current customers of Masterway Telecomunicacois include banks,
manufacturers, service companies and major telecommunications
carriers.

During the period 1997-99, Brazil migrated from a state owned
monopoly for telecommunications to a fully privatized and
competitive private sector. Investment by the new telecom
operators over the next 3 years is estimated to be US$25 billion.
Brazil is a large country which several large cities such as Sao
Paulo and Rio De Janeiro and many smaller regional centers. This
situation creates significant challenges for the delivery of data
communications services. The result is that both domestic and
international data communications costs are very high and the
service quality is highly variable, conditions that the CYH
products are designed to address.

Over the past several months, CYH has been working with Masterway
and their associates to understand the value of the CYH products
in the Brazilian market where the additional bandwidth gained by
using the CYH equipment provides a payback in a few weeks to a few
months. The new telecommunications investment and challenges of
the marketplace create an ideal environment for the CYH products.
Masterway's experience in communication hardware allows them to be
ideal partners to help both end users and data communications
service providers take advantage of the CYH technology.

The CYH products are designed to extend bandwidth of Wide Area
Network (WAN) Services. Data communications carriers provide these
WAN services on a monthly basis depending upon capacity. By using
the CYH hardware, carriers are able to offer a Premium Data
Service without a major investment in communications
infrastructure. The family of CYH data link optimization products
deliver up to four times the throughput normally available on
existing data links. The value of the extra bandwidth obtained
from the use of the hardware is very dependant upon the local
costs of bandwidth. With demand for bandwidth growing faster than
the infrastructure can grow, an opportunity is created for
effective bandwidth optimization technologies.
